Chamber History

The actual date of formation of the Fallbrook Chamber of Commerce is unclear; however, there is reason to believe the Chamber existed as early as 1915. Fallbrook earned its title of “The Friendly Village” early in 1922 when then-president R.H. Blacklidge sponsored a Frost Free Lemon Celebration Day. One of the chief attractions of this day was the offering of unlimited quantities of lemonade to travelers passing through town when Main Avenue (as we know it today) was Highway 395.

The Chamber was incorporated in 1949 when Carroll Husher served as president. Its first official office was opened in 1958, at 303 S. Main Avenue. Prior to that, the Chamber office was located wherever its president was. In 1967, the Chamber office moved to 300 N. Main Street. Several years later, the office was moved to 233 E. Mission and then, in 2012, to its current location at 111 S. Main Street (Avenue now).

Over the years, the Chamber of Commerce has been active in the promotion and development of water resources and has been responsible for much of the improvement of streets and street lighting in Fallbrook. Committees of the Chamber have been instrumental in establishing the local fire department, the airpark, improvement programs for business buildings and a long-range planning program for the general community. It contributes to the economic growth of the “village” and also serves as a quasi-governmental agency for its residents. The Board of Directors is a voluntary organization of businessmen and women devoted to encouraging commerce and supporting industry, as well as promoting common interests and reflecting business opinion as it relates to matters of the community, state, region, and nation.

The Chamber has actively worked for the continued progress and betterment of this community, from the day it was formed to the present. It has a consistent record of fighting for more and better road improvements and street lighting, and can take credit for most of the progress made along these lines. It has also supported countless beautification programs to help restore the natural beauty of the area.

Unlike most other Chambers, the Fallbrook Chamber serves as a quasi-governmental agency serving not only the needs of the community, but the needs of its residents as well. If it cannot be of direct assistance, it seeks to put the individual in touch with someone who can help. It greets newcomers, answers questions and promotes the image of the “Friendly Village.”

The Chamber maintains a rigorous focus on its mission “To support business and build a better community.” Alongside this are the residual, yet necessary, components of its function such as: complaint department, city hall, town council, information center, traveler’s aid station, business referral house, central meeting place, county liaison, directory service, ticket office and drop center for a variety of things like books, computers and even cookies!
